Interested in Serving the Board?

Board members serve three-year terms and meet four times annually. Throughout the year, members work on one of six committees: Scholarships & Awards, Nominations & Elections, Membership, College Relations, Promotions & Visibility and Communications.

Board Responsibilities
Being a member of the Board is more than meetings. Members do meet on campus (or via video chat) at least four times a semester, hearing from the dean, faculty, and students about the college, their research and experiences, and meeting in their individual committees. They serve as representatives of the Alumni Association and the College at University and College events. Members are also responsible for selecting scholarship and award recipients, planning events regionally and in East Lansing to engage other alumni and support current students, and working to promote the college.
